Part 1—Preliminary

1—Short title

These regulations may be cited as the Rail Safety National Law (South Australia) (Drug and Alcohol Testing) (Approval of Apparatus) Variation Regulations 2018.

2—Commencement

These regulations will come into operation on 24 April 2018.

3—Variation provisions

In these regulations, a provision under a heading referring to the variation of specified regulations varies the regulations so specified.

Part 2—Variation of Rail Safety National Law (South Australia) (Drug and Alcohol Testing) Regulations 2012

4—Insertion of regulation 3A

After regulation 3 insert:

3A—Approval of apparatus

(1)For the purposes of Part 4 of the Act and Part 3 Division 9 of the Rail Safety National Law, apparatus of the following kind is approved for the purposes of conducting alcotests:

AlcoQuant 6020.

(2)For the purposes of Part 4 of the Act and Part 3 Division 9 of the Rail Safety National Law, apparatus of the following kind is approved for the purposes of conducting drug screening tests:

Medvet Oral7 Point of Collection Device.

Note—

As required by section 10AA(2) of the Subordinate Legislation Act 1978, the Minister has certified that, in the Minister's opinion, it is necessary or appropriate that these regulations come into operation as set out in these regulations.
